The ethics of care offers inspiring ways to think about the relationships and connections we are part of. It provides a new and unconventional reading and understanding of human relationships, thereby enabling us to respond in new and appropriate ways to certain empirical challenges (Pettersen 2011, p. 51).

Just twenty-five years ago, thinking about care was associated with women’s decisions in the private sphere concerning their personal dilemmas and problems. Over the last two decades, advocates of the ethics of care have demonstrated that the ideal of care has the potential to regulate not only private behavior but also human interactions in general.

Today, ideas about care have the power to change how we evaluate personal relationships, professional conduct, public policy, international relations, and global issues. The relevance of the ethics of care in such a wide range of areas of life, many of which are characterized by mutual incompatibilities and conflicting interests, is conditioned by several factors. However, one of the most significant is the creativity and fruitfulness of the thinking of the representatives of the ethics of care, who develop ethical concepts, models, and methods capable of grasping and analyzing human relationships in all their diversity (Pettersen 2011, p. 52).

Compared to traditional ethical concepts and theories in moral philosophy, the ethics of care introduces radically different sets of models and normative concepts. Today, it is precisely feminist ethics of care that offers a critical reflection on care within the realm of moral philosophy, ethics, and social philosophy. The aim of this publication is to identify the concept, subject, approach, philosophical foundations and starting points, as well as the possibilities for applying the ethics of care as a specific moral approach and, at the same time, as a specific moral theory in the field of social science and humanities research.

The university textbook "Pregraduate Teacher Preparation – Organization of Pedagogical Practice at UPJŠ" reflects the changes that have occurred in the pregraduate preparation of students of academic subject teaching in connection with the comprehensive accreditation in 2015. It is intended for students of the second level of university studies in the study programs of Academic Subject Teaching at the Faculty of Arts and the Faculty of Science at UPJŠ in Košice. The aim of the university textbook is to provide theoretical foundations and methodological guidelines for the organization of all types of pedagogical practice carried out under the conditions of UPJŠ.

Preparation for the teaching profession has both theoretical and practical components. While theoretical academic preparation focuses on acquiring and developing knowledge, skills, and competencies in pedagogy, psychology, and the scientific disciplines of the teaching subjects, practical professional preparation is oriented towards preparing for the actual performance of the profession, i.e., the didactic aspect of the teaching process. A significant part of the practical preparation for the teaching profession is realized within the subject of pedagogical practice, which at UPJŠ takes four forms/levels – Observational pedagogical-psychological practice, Ongoing teaching practice, Continuous teaching practice I, and Continuous teaching practice II.

The monograph "Risk as a Social Category in Adolescence" by Dušan Šlosár was created as part of the VEGA project No. 1-0285/18, which focuses on risky behavior among adolescents as clients of social work due to their loneliness. The monograph explores the issue of risk in a theoretical context and integrates risk as a component of social relationships, contacts, and information exchange. From this theoretical foundation, it defines risk within helping professions. Assessing the level of risk is left to leading managers; however, it currently affects those helping professionals who work with specific client groups, and thus their involvement in assessing the level of risk cannot be overlooked.

The monograph pays special attention to risky behavior among adolescents and discusses the most serious forms of such behavior, ranging from suicidality to crime, substance abuse (both material and non-material), and issues related to sexuality. The conclusion of the monograph consists of three empirical studies that address the topic of risky behavior among adolescents.
